What are the rules for placing Christmas trees in a business?
Artificial Trees, Garlands and Wreaths: Place trees away from exits or aisle ways. Make sure that the tree stand or other support systems is sufficient to keep the tree from falling over. Secure wreaths and garlands sufficiently so that they won’t fall off or become dislodged during an emergency. Natural Trees, Garlands and Wreaths: NEVER PLACE CANDLES OR OTHER OPEN FLAME DEVICES ON OR NEAR NATURAL TREES, GARLANDS OR WREATHS! Use only fresh trees. Locate trees away from aisles and exits and away from furnace air outlets or other heating devices. Prior to placing the tree in a stand make a fresh cut across the base of the tree trunk 1″ or more above the original cut. Immediately place the tree in the stand and supply water.
